The Visionary Beginnings of Comme des Garçons

Rei Kawakubo's vision for Comme des Garçons was far from typical. She did not see fashion as simply a way to clothe the body but as a medium to express deeper ideas about culture, art, and society. From its inception, the brand was not about following trends but about creating its own distinct language. Kawakubo’s approach was, and still is, based on breaking traditional rules of fashion design, rejecting the common structures and forms of clothing in favor of something far more experimental.

The early collections from Comme des Garçons were seen as radical and challenging. At a time when the fashion world was dominated by European luxury houses known for their elegant tailoring and feminine silhouettes, Kawakubo introduced designs that were androgynous, oversized, and deconstructed. Her collections did not adhere to the conventional idea of beauty, and yet they exuded a strange kind of grace that captivated fashion insiders and outsiders alike. The juxtaposition of rough, unfinished fabrics with artistic shapes conveyed a sense of rebellion against the polished, perfected looks of the past, while maintaining an underlying sense of sophisticated innovation.

The Intersection of Elegance and Innovation

What sets Comme des Garçons apart from other fashion houses is its unique ability to merge conceptual innovation with timeless elegance. Kawakubo never abandoned elegance, but rather redefined it. Her designs may have been unorthodox, but they were never devoid of beauty. In fact, many of her pieces possess a raw, organic quality that enhances their beauty, turning what would typically be seen as flaws into deliberate and meaningful statements.

One of the ways Comme des Garçons achieves this balance is through its use of silhouette and fabric. Unlike many of its contemporaries, the brand often eschews traditional patterns and construction methods, opting instead for experimentation with shapes, textures, and volume. This approach to tailoring is where the conceptual innovation comes in. However, Kawakubo’s genius lies in the way she maintains an aura of elegance despite the seemingly haphazard design choices. Even in her most extreme pieces, there is always an inherent sense of grace that makes the garments wearable, desirable, and intriguing. The forms may be exaggerated, the cuts asymmetrical, and the materials unfamiliar, but the result is always something that feels like art while still retaining a sense of wearability.

The way the brand plays with proportions is also essential to its understanding of elegance and innovation. Where other designers might use minimalism or symmetry to convey elegance, Comme des Garçons uses distortion. Long, flowing garments may twist and turn unexpectedly, skirts may flare out in unpredictable directions, and jackets may hang asymmetrically. Yet, despite the avant-garde nature of these pieces, they still manage to maintain an aura of poise. This balance between the experimental and the graceful is what makes Comme des Garçons’ creations so mesmerizing and often ahead of their time.

The Role of Conceptual Fashion in Society

Comme des Garçons is not merely a fashion label; it is a cultural force. The brand’s conceptual approach to fashion allows it to engage with larger societal issues and questions. Kawakubo’s designs are often inspired by philosophical ideas, societal observations, and even critiques of consumerism. Fashion, in her view, is not just about creating clothing to sell—it is about making a statement, provoking thought, and offering a new way of thinking about the world.

One of the most notable examples of this is the "body" collections, where Kawakubo created garments that distorted the human form, reflecting her interest in the Comme Des Garcons Hoodie relationship between the body and the clothes it wears. These collections challenged the traditional ideals of the female body, focusing on volume and shape rather than adhering to the classic notions of femininity or masculinity. Through this, Comme des Garçons highlighted the fluidity of identity, offering a more expansive and inclusive view of what fashion could represent.

Similarly, Comme des Garçons has often incorporated social and political commentary into its designs. For instance, in her Spring/Summer 2018 collection, Kawakubo used a range of fabrics with striking patterns and bold, graphic prints, reflecting on the chaos and uncertainty of the modern world. Each collection becomes a vehicle for the designer to express complex ideas, offering her audience not just clothes, but a reflection on the world around them. This ability to engage with broader cultural issues while still offering wearable, elegant pieces is a hallmark of Comme des Garçons’ success in blending conceptual innovation with elegance.
